    So, theonejrs, you want to discuss the Pentium 4 prescott? Go right ahead and discuss until your fingers bleed from the friction.

    Even if the Prescotts are old, they are by no means weak per se. They are great for overclocking and can more than easily hit 3.8GHz which puts them in good standing with most single core AMDs.

    Some are a bit weak at stock settings but after 3.4GHz they're plenty fast enough. I don't see a need to denounce a perfectly good current gen CPU because it's just old.

    Most games only really need a 3.0GHz Pentium 4 to play at high settings. Oblivion is the ONLY exception to this so far. Even FEAR will do just fine with a 2.8GHz.

    As I remember the P4 is faster than the Athlon XP but that didn't stop people buying them.

    Sometimes raw speed isn't important we forget that when we get all heated about the performance leader. If a P4 540 gets the job done well whats the point of springing $1000 for an X6800? I mean the speed is awesome but isn't PC building all about doing your best with what you can get on the cheapest budget possible? I think so. That's why I choose it as my hobby.
